Factor the quadratic expression 7x2-45x-28 completely.


Open in App
Solution

Factor the quadratic polynomial 7x2-45x-28:

Find the product of the quadratic term 7x2 and the constant term -28, 7x2×-28=-196x2 . Through a hit and trial process, we have to find two factors of -196x2 that add up to give the linear term -45x. The two factors that satisfy these conditions are -49x and 4x, because their sum is equal to the linear term -45x and their product is equal to -196x2.

Rewrite -45x in the expression 7x2-45x-28 as -49x+4x.

Then factorize by grouping the terms:

7x2-45x-28=7x2-49x+4x-28=7x2-49x+4x-28=7xx-7+4x-7=x-77x+4

Thus, 7x2-45x-28 is completely factorized to obtain (x-7)(7x+4).
